Christine Ferron is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Clinical Psychology and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Christine Ferron has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 328 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in General Health Professions, 8 papers in Clinical Psychology and 5 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Christine Ferron’s work include Healthcare Systems and Practices (11 papers), Health Policy Implementation Science (6 papers) and School Health and Nursing Education (4 papers). Christine Ferron is often cited by papers focused on Healthcare Systems and Practices (11 papers), Health Policy Implementation Science (6 papers) and School Health and Nursing Education (4 papers). Christine Ferron collaborates with scholars based in France, Switzerland and Canada. Christine Ferron's co-authors include Pierre‐André Michaud, Pierre Michaud, F Narring, Françoise Narring, A Jeannin, Robert W. Blum, Jean‐Pierre Deschamps, F Dubois-Arber, Jeanine Pommier and R Guéguen and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Adolescent Health, Acta Psychiatrica Scandinavica and International Journal of Eating Disorders.
